Alexi Pappas Making Her Return to the Track in San Diego

By Adam Kopet

Alexi Pappas announced her return to the track Thursday on Instagram. She will be lining up to race the Pacific Pursuit 10K, a 10,000-meter race hosted by the Roots Running Project at UC San Diego.

This will be Pappas' first race on the track since she competed at the 2016 Olympics in the 10,000 meters for Greece. According to the IAAF, she has competed in three road races since then, including the 2018 Chicago Marathon, where she finished 28th in 2:43:38. During that span, Pappas has been busy making movies, including the recently completed Olympic Dreams.

The Roots Running Project announced Friday that the Pacific Pursuit 10K has been moved from its originally scheduled Sunday to Monday morning.

One of the stated goals of the event is to help athletes meet the IAAF World Outdoor Championships and the Olympic standards. Sunday's weather report in San Diego is reportedly calling for strong winds that would make reaching those standards more difficult.

Also scheduled to compete in the event are Stephanie Bruce, Allie Kieffer, Alice Wright, Ann Marie Blaney and Olivia Pratt. The men's race features Noah Droddy, Reid Buchanan, Reed Fischer and Ian La Mere.
